Sas simulation studio provides the tools you need to model all of the important elements of a system. Abstract this paper will be chapter in simulation in the elsevier series of handbooks in operations research and management science, edited by shane henderson and barry nelson. The flow option of proc report is only a listing destination option. Different types of statistical distributions on which sas simulation can be applied is listed below. Pharmasug 2014 paper po17 healthcare data manipulation. These include missing, corrupted, inconsistent, or nonstandardized data. Although accessible to a wide range of sas users, even experienced users will learn clever new tricks for data generation, management and analysis. Using ods pdf, previously it was possible to mark a place for the line to wrap to the function was m in the prior version. Sas is an integrated software suite for advanced analytics, business intelligence, data management, and predictive analytics. Proceedings of the 2016 winter simulation conference t. Its graphical user interface provides a full set of tools for building, executing, and analyzing the results.
Fenghsiu su, msba, mph1, 3, philamer atienza, ms1, 2. In fact, if i run the hundreds of programs in my 300page book simulating data with sas, the cumulative time is only a few minutes, with the longestrunning program requiring only about 30 seconds. Data generated by a simulation model can easily be saved as a sas. Wordwrapping text output in sas reports lex jansen. Mathematical optimization, discreteevent simulation, and or.
Datadriven simulation the do loop sas blogs sas blogs. Simulation of data using the sas system, tools for learning and experimentation, continued 2 functions may have shorter periods. Ods pdf table text wrapping sas support communities. Rick wicklins new book, simulating data with sas, is highly approachable, and shows how the power of the iml language can be harnessed with other elements of the sas system to make simulation easy. Discreteevent simulation, and or sasiml software and matrix.
So, for example stomatological preparations, the s at the end is crossi. Fenghsiu su, msba, mph1, 3, philamer atienza, ms1, 2, karan. We conducted simulation study based upon 10,000 replicates of data. All code for executing simulation based examples is written for use with the sas software and was coded using sas version 9. This is a wonderful resource for anyone considering the use of monte carlo simulation methodology in sas. Schacherer, clinical data management systems, llc brent d. We studied the effect of varying sample size and the number of measurements time points on power. Simulation of data using the sas system, tools for. In this lab, well learn how to simulate data with r using random number generators of different kinds of mixture variables we control.
Sas analyst for windows tutorial university of texas at. Unlike previous labs where the homework was done via ohms, this lab will require you to submit short answers, submit plots as aesthetic as possible, and also some code. The ranbin function derives the variate from the random binomial. In addition, we will study different procedures for missing data analysis in sas stat with examples. Access to nonsas database management systems requires a. When using any of the sas graph justification options jl, jc, and jr, sas divides titles and footnotes into equal thirds on an ods printer pcl pdf ps page. Data management, statistical analysis, and graphics, second edition explains how to easily perform an analytical task in both sas and r, without having to navigate through the extensive, idiosyncratic, and sometimes unwieldy software documentation. Simulation of data using the sas system, tools for learning and experimentation, continued 4 trials of ten coin tosses, which follow a binomial distribution. Although the data step is a useful tool for simulating univariate data, sas iml software is more powerful for simulating multivariate data. Very often, business analysts and other professionals with little or no programming experience are required to learn sas. Use the data step to simulate data from univariate and uncorrelated multivariate distributions.
Ten tips for simulating data with sas rick wicklin, sas institute inc. Mstoolkit an r library for simulating and evaluating clinical trial. If you adjust cellwidth, and if your text string has a place to break, you can sometimes use only cellwidth as shown in shortvar2 and with both the longvar and longvar2 columns in the program output below. The statement can be modified to wrap a standard template to any table, listing or figure created within sas, via rscript or a picture as shown in figure 1. Sas system, i propose a simulation approach to assess the risk of claims. Data generated by a sas simulation studio model can be collected and saved either. A sas primer for healthcare data analysts christopher w. Westra, mayo clinic health solutions abstract as in other fields, analysts in. Panasonic offers a device library for circuit simulators that help design circuits more efficiently. Healthcare data manipulation and analytics using sas, continued other challenges in healthcare data are the large volume, complexity and heterogeneity of medical data and their poor mathematical.
The european nafems spdm conference will offer a unique forum where experts from different industries, academia, consultancies and software vendors will share their knowledge regarding simulation process and data management concepts and solutions covering the following topics. Sas life science customer connection executive briefing center, sas global headquarters cary, nc agenda may 45, 2017 day 1 thurs. Sas software provides many techniques for simulating data from a variety of statistical models. Analytic modeling methods often fall short of providing detailed depictions of systems with complex relationships and random variations. Horton and ken kleinman incorporating the latest r packages as well as new case studies and applications, using r and rstudio for data management, statistical analysis, and graphics, second edition covers the aspects of r most often used by statistical. You can use the rand function to generate random values from more than 20 standard univariate distributions. Data preparation for data mining using sas mamdouh refaat amsterdam boston heidelberg london new york oxford paris san diego san francisco singapore sydney tokyo morgan kaufmann publishers is an imprint of elsevier. Now i am using pdf anchor, ods proclabel and proc document to replay my. Simulation of data using the sas system, tools for learning. Robust stateoftheart molecular simulation engines and molecular dynamics and monte. Sep 27, 2017 the simulation in that article uses an input data set that contains the parameters mean, standard deviations, and correlations for the simulation.
Sample size by simulation for clinical trials with survival. Unfortunately, md, like other simulation techniques, suffers from heavy computational time and production of large raw data. Dymola users manual computer science eth zurich eth zurich. This chapter describes the two most important techniques that are used to simulate data in sas software. For most of the table, the text is wrapped correctly, however occasionally longer words will fail to break properly. Versatile sample size calculation using simulation. Abstract data simulation is a fundamental tool for statistical programmers. In fact, if i run the hundreds of programs in my 300page book simulating data with sas, the cumulative time is. Do you wonder how to get rtf or pdf output to have page x of y. The simulation in that article uses an input data set that contains the parameters mean, standard deviations, and correlations for the simulation. Rick wicklins simulating data with sas brings together the most useful algorithms and the best programming. Sas simulation studio provides the tools you need to model all of. You can use sas software through both a graphical interface and the sas programming language, or base sas. This simulation runs in a fraction of a second, so you dont need to parallelize it.
Learn sas in 50 minutes subhashree singh, the hartford, hartford, ct abstract sas is the leading business analytics software used in a variety of business domains such as insurance, healthcare, pharmacy, telecom etc. We fitted a random intercept model employing a longitudinal design. While this may seem to be a large number, the online documentation warns that. Introduction to sas for data analysis uncg quantitative methodology series 4 2 what can i do with sas. Data management, statistical analysis, and graphics, second edition explains how to easily perform an analytical task in both sas and r, without having to. Sas simulation studio can input stored data to a model, reading in single values or single rows. Hi all, im creating a table using ods pdf and proc report and am having an issue with the text wrapping.
By using the techniques in my book, you can write efficient. Most examples use either the matrix algebrabased iml procedure or the data step, with a multitude of other sas procedures used to illustrate important concepts. Rick wicklins simulating data with sas brings together the most useful algorithms and the best programming techniques for efficient data simulation in an accessible howto book for practicing statisticians and statistical programmers. Modeling signalized traffic intersections using sas. The simulated distribution, generated with random variables from three probability distributions, gives an effective and graphic tool to assess the claims risk exposure. Or, have you ever needed to make one part of a text string bold or a different color. Why does the second and third lines wrap, despite using tagattrwraptext, while the first one does not wrap. By that we mean, not the traditional important methods to design statistical experiments, but rather techniques that can be used, before a simulation is conducted, to estimate the computational e. There are three primary ways to simulate data in sas software. The elements of functions that are the same for gas and sas are.
Note on downloading the specifications of listed products may be subject to change or the supply of listed products may stop without notice. Data management, statistical analysis, and graphics, second edition explains how to easily perform an analytical task in. The data step reads data from the temporary sas data set wghtclub and stores it in a permanent data set of the same name. Procedures for power and sample size analysis in sas stat. Sas simulation studio currently experimental in sas or 9.
When used on a data statement, the effect is to create a sas data set in that directory. Sample size by simulation for clinical trials with. Rick wicklins simulating data with sas brings collectively in all probability probably the most useful algorithms and the most effective programming strategies for surroundings pleasant data simulation in an accessible howto book for coaching statisticians and statistical programmers. Hi i have been trying to wrap text in the ods pdf file but i could not get it.
In our last sas stat tutorial, we talk about mixed model procedure. Horton and ken kleinman incorporating the latest r packages as well as new case studies and applications, using r. The sas data steps needed to perform these tasks are shown in box 1. Modeling with simulation studio simulation studio is a sas software package that uses objectoriented discreteevent simulation to model and analyze systems. Generating models from a car type simulation in sas. The simulated data produced by the model is as realistic as possible. Foundations of econometrics using sas simulations and. Boxcoxtrans function is basically a wrapper for the boxcox function in the mass library. That is why the vba functions offered by easyfitxl allow you to evaluate most common distribution functions pdf, cdf etc. Most ods destinations ignore the flow option among others. A simple simulation in the following simplified simulation for inpatient care, i start. You can also store an entire data set and query it as needed specifying the desired column, row or cell during. Data standards and management in sas life science analytics framework v. Monte carlo simulation approach to assess health care.
Rick wicklins simulating data with sas brings collectively in all probability probably the most useful algorithms and. Following procedures are used to compute sas power and sample size analysis of a sample data. The proc power procedure performs sas power and sample analysis, which covers a variety of sample analysis such as ttests, one way anova, regression and. All code for executing simulationbased examples is written for use with the sas software and was coded using sas version 9. Healthcare data manipulation and analytics using sas, continued other challenges in healthcare data are the large volume, complexity and heterogeneity of medical data and their poor mathematical characterization and non canonical form. Sas power and sample size analysis procedures dataflair. Rick wicklins new book, simulating data with sas, is highly approachable, and shows how the power of the iml language can be harnessed with other elements of the sas system to make simulation. Foundations of econometrics using sas simulations and examples. Ods html somthing like the flow option that is good for ods listing. How to wrap text in ods pdf file report sas support communities.
Sample size by simulation for clinical trials with survival outcomes. Data frame from which variables specified in formula are preferentially to be. Today we are going to look at sas missing data analysis. Pharmasug 2014 paper po17 healthcare data manipulation and. To learn how to use the sas iml language effectively, see. Data simulation is a fundamental tool for statistical programmers. You can also store an entire data set and query it as needed specifying the desired column, row or cell during the simulation run.
Data simulation is a fundamental technique in statistical programming and research. Jul 18, 2012 this simulation runs in a fraction of a second, so you dont need to parallelize it. Rick wicklins simulating data with sas brings collectively in all probability probably the most useful algorithms and the most effective programming strategies for surroundings pleasant data simulation in an accessible howto book. Sas analyst for windows tutorial 6 the department of statistics and data sciences, the university of texas at austin the first two lines of the program simply instruct sas to open the sas dataset fitness. Monte carlo simulation approach to assess health care claims. Mstoolkit provides easy linking to sas as the analytic engine. Sas simulation studio currently experimental in sasor 9. Robust state oftheart molecular simulation engines and molecular dynamics and monte. While this may seem to be a large number, the online documentation warns. Note on downloading the specifications of listed products may be subject to change or the supply of listed. Retaining the same accessible format as the popular first edition, sas and r.
Sas has a very large number of components customized for specific industries and data analysis tasks. Sas is an integrated software suite for advanced analytics, business intelligence, data. Data simulation is a elementary technique in statistical programming and evaluation. If you adjust cellwidth, and if your text string has a place to. The european nafems spdm conference will offer a unique forum where experts from different industries, academia, consultancies and software vendors will share their knowledge regarding.
Rick wicklins simulating data with sas brings together the most useful algorithms and the best. The simulation mode is used to make experiment on the model, plot results and animate the behavior. Ods pdf wrapping title text containing preimage sas. Its graphical user interface provides a full set of tools for building, executing, and analyzing the results of discrete event simulation models. Because this is an equal split, it is difficult to wrap text across the height of an image included with the preimage style attribute. The book is ideal for selflearners who already have a grounding in statistical modelling using sas stat and who wish to learn simulation. A sas procedure proc simnormal simulates data based on the parameters in the input data set. Data preparation for data mining using sas mamdouh refaat amsterdam boston heidelberg london new york oxford paris san diego san francisco singapore sydney tokyo. Do you have any ideas about what i am doing incorrectly. This tutorial is designed for all those readers who want to read and transform raw data to produce insights for business using sas. Using r and rstudio for data management, statistical analysis, and graphics nicholas j. Atomistic modelling of scattering data in the collaborative. For this example, the following only breaks a text string into four.